HOW TO TOP-UP THE SYSTEM PRESSURE (fig. 3)
The system pressure must be checked periodically
to ensure the correct operation of the boiler. The
needle on the gauge should be reading between
1 and 1.5 bar when the boiler is in an off position
and has cooled to room temperature.If the
pressure requires ‘topping-up’ use the following
instructions as a guide.
●
Locate the filling valve connections (usually
beneath the boiler).
●
Attach the filling loop to both connections.
●
Open the filling valve slowly until you hear
water entering the system.
●
Close the filling valve when the pressure gauge
(on the boiler) reads between 1 and 1.5 bar.
●
Remove the filling loop from the connections.
3.2
HOW TO RESET THE APPLIANCE
When the status light is illuminated red, the
appliance will require to be reset manually. Before
resetting the boiler ensure that the pressure
gauge is indicating the correct level. Allow a
period of two minutes to elapse before pressing
the reset button.
IMPORTANT
If the appliance requires to be reset frequently, it may
be indicative of a fault, please contact your installer or
Vokera Customer Services for further advice.
3.3
HOW TO SHUT DOWN THE SYSTEM FOR
SHORT PERIODS
The system and boiler can be shut down for short
periods by simply turning the time clock to the off
position. It is also advisable to turn off the main
water supply to the house.
3.4
HOW TO SHUT DOWN THE SYSTEM FOR
LONG PERIODS
If the house is to be left unoccupied for any length
of time – especially during the winter – the system
should be thoroughly drained of all water.
The gas, water, and electricity supply to the
house should also be turned off. For more detailed
advice contact your installer.
3.5
HOW TO CARE FOR THE APPLIANCE
To clean the outer casing use only a clean damp
cloth. Do not use any scourers or abrasive
cleaners.

4.1
WHAT IF I SUSPECT A GAS LEAK
If you suspect a gas leak, turn off the gas supply
at the gas meter, and contact your installer or
local gas supplier. If you require further advice
please contact your nearest Vokera office.
4.2
WHAT IF I HAVE TO FREQUENTLY TOP-UP
THE SYSTEM
If the system regularly requires topping-up, it may
be indicative of a leak. Please contact your installer
and ask him to inspect the system.
4.3
WHAT IF THE RESET LIGHT IS ON
If the reset light is flashing res it indicates
that the boiler has failed to ignite or has
overheated, when this happens the boiler
automatically shuts down and requires to be
reset manually (see 3.2).
